  4. Disneyland Slows Down Mark Twain

    When the Mark Twain and Columbia return to the Rivers of America July 29, they will be traveling slower in order to maintain their traditional ride duration of 14 to 15 minutes.

    Since the reconfigured river is shorter, the ride time could have been cut.
